Inside the Print Shop 1
Course Length: Quarter Course
Credit: 0.25 credit
Grades: 9-12
Prerequisite(s): Production Printing Explorations
Course Description: This asynchronous course introduces students to the many ways printed products are created and used in the real world. Students explore different types of printing, including commercial printing, books and publications, packaging, signs, direct mail, and secure documents. The course explains how print shops are organized, how jobs move from design to finished product, and why accuracy and security matter. Students also learn how printed items are finished, delivered, and installed. The course highlights how printing adapts to new materials, technology, and everyday challenges.
